基于模块的教学与传统的讲座在小儿医学本科教学:一个准实验性研究
Susy Joseph1, Veena Anand2, G K Libu3
1Department of Pediatrics, SAT Hospital, Government Medical College, Thiruvananthapuram, Kerala, India. drsusy2772@gmail.com.
与传统讲座相比,基于模块的教学显著提高了医学学生在儿科方面的知识. 学生的看法也倾向于基于模块的方法,这表明它对本科医学教育的优越性.

背景情况:
- 传统的讲座是本科医学教育的传统方法.
- 评估新的教学方法对于提高学习成果至关重要.
研究的目的:
- 为了比较基于模块的教学与本科儿科教育的传统讲座的有效性.
主要方法:
- 一项涉及100名MBBS学生的准实验性研究,分为基于模块的和传统的讲座组.
- 通过前测试和后测试评估学习成果;用五分利克特尺度评估感知.
主要成果:
- 基于模块的教学显示了知识获取的统计学上显著改善 (P < 0.001).
- 与传统讲座相比,更高比例的学生 (72%) 对基于模块的教学有积极的看法.
结论:
- 基于模块的教学证明了在儿科本科教育中获得卓越的知识和更积极的学生看法.
- 这种方法为改善医疗培训提供了传统讲座的有希望的替代方案.
